Project

Characterisation and diagnostics of plant-parasitic nematodes from medicinal plants in Vietnam and biological control strategies for their sustainable management

This study investigates the diversity, abundance, and effective identification of plant-parasitic nematodes from medicinal plants in Vietnam. Endophytic bacteria will be tested and selected to increase the yield and to avoid the unnecessary use of hazardous agrochemicals. By involving
various stakeholders, this project also aims to increase awareness of nematode problems and solutions in crop protection throughout Vietnam
